Student-Athlete Philosophy
Quad Body
Our athletes must be able to accomplish their basic functions as great sons, great citizens,
great students and great athletes. This is the standard of the La Costa Canyon High School
Freshman Football Team. Every player has vowed to work hard to represent their family,
community, school and team in a positive light every day. This is a tough task, but luckily we
have great teammates to help us stay on point. The following is a breakdown of the exact actions
a member on our team must ATTACK:
Great Son - Honoring your parents with the utmost respect. Being a loyal family member.
Taking charge of your daily chores and getting them done on time. Mentor your younger siblings.
Represent your family with pride.
Great Citizen – Involve yourself positively in the community. Get to know community
leaders and people of influence in the area. Volunteer!!! Always say hello to Law enforcement
and Fire department professionals.
Great Student – We sit in the front row of every class. Assist the teacher with keeping
order in the class. Turn in your homework on time. Don’t always take the easy assignment,
challenge yourself in the classroom as you do on the field. Embrace learning. Educate others,
mentor others, help other succeed in class. Always be a student first!
Great Athlete – Prepare your body and mind for physical and mental challenges. Keep
your equipment clean and ready for battle. Trust your coaches and earn the trust of your
teammates. Become a student of the game. Lead when it’s your time to do so. Last but not least,
always ATTACK! (100%, 100% of the time).
